// Cache TTL for the Pellworth catalog service. Don't crank this up —
// price updates from the Dunmore feed land every 5 min, and a stale
// cache means wrong prices on the storefront. If invalidation looks
// stuck, flush the catalog namespace first. Last verified against the
// build noted below.

session token of kahif-kageg = htk14_01cd78718aea51

Quarterly Planning Note — Divestiture of the Coastal Tooling Unit

For the finance team: the sale of the Coastal Tooling unit to Pellmark Industries remains on track for close in Q3. Please finalize the carve-out balance sheet, reconcile intercompany positions, and prepare the working-capital adjustment schedule by month-end. Audit support requests should be prioritized. For planning purposes, note the following sensitive item:

internal memo for hawef-kahif: The finance team signed off on a budget of $25.9 million for Project Sorox. The renewal with Pelokek Logistics closes at $51.7 million a year, 52 percent below the last contract.

**Key Ceremony Checklist — Item 9: StormRelay Fan-out Keys**

New members: StormRelay distributes weather alerts to downstream partners, so its signing keys are ceremony-controlled. Steps: confirm quorum of three custodians present; verify the HSM serial against the Dunmarsh registry; rotate the fan-out signing key; re-sign the partner manifest; test one alert through the staging fan-out. Do not proceed if any custodian check fails. To unseal the custodian vault for the rotation step, enter the recovery passphrase below.

unlock words, yawig-kagef: gordor-holvan-ulaael-pramir-ulaiel-tamdor